Netflix has confirmed the release date for “Berlin and the Lady with an Ermine,” the next entry in the “Money Heist” saga.
Set in Seville, the show has Berlin and company doing another heist, pretending to steal the Lady with an Ermine. Their real target is the Duke of Málaga and his wife, a couple trying to blackmail Berlin. But instead, they wake up his darkest side, and it’s thirsty for revenge.

Pedro Alonso (“Berlin,” “Money Heist”), Michelle Jenner (“Isabel”), Tristán Ulloa (“The Asunta Case”), Begoña Vargas (“Welcome to Eden”), Julio Peña Fernández (“The Captive”), and Joel Sánchez (“La favorita 1922”) will all reprise their respective roles. They are joined by franchise newcomer Inma Cuesta (“The Mess You Leave Behind”), who plays Candela, a new addition to Berlin’s gang, and she steals his heart. José Luis García-Pérez (“Honor”) and Marta Nieto (“Mother”) are also joining the cast as the Duke and Duchess of Málaga.

Creators Álex Pina and Esther Martínez Lobato (“Sky Rojo”) will return to write and showrun with David Barrocal, Lorena G. Maldonado, Itziar Sanjuán, Humberto Ortega, and Luis Garrido Julve. Albert Pintó will be returning to direct some episodes alongside David Barrocal (“Billionaires’ Bunker”) and José Manuel Cravioto (“Diablero”).
“Berlin and the Lady with an Ermine” will hit Netflix on May 15th. You can check out the date announcement video below:
